
Expedition An ancient tomb called "Libet" in the Cinderbreach.
Dates November 13-19th, 2011
Inspirations Indiana Jones, Tomb Raider, National Treasure, the Mines of Moria, Raithwall's Tomb.
General plotline Travelers explore a tomb they find in the Cinderbreach mountains, only to discover its origins... and what is buried there, in the deep labyrinthian twists and turns.
Miscellaneous Characters will face obstacles (collapsed walls, floors, etc) as well as mazes, and for a portion will be divided into groups to get through (courtesy walls dropping into place to divide them up.) Like the Park Ride in Jurassic Park, it will hopefully give characters a little bit of time with a smaller group to build CR. There will be some fighting, though it will be minimal.

Sunday, November 13th Residents set out for the Cinderbreach. They make camp in the mountains that night, and encounter some strange native creatures.
Monday, November 14th They arrive at the tomb's opening and, as a group, manage to open the door. Unfortunately, once they enter, the doors swing closed behind them and are sealed by a glowing white light. To get back out, they'll have to find the right artifacts and put them on the altars. They continue on, and make camp in an atrium. Sleep well... if you can!!!1
Tuesday, November 15th While traveling through the caves, things get crazy: while the residents are walking, a sudden cave-in leaves the residents divided with no way to reach each other. The only way on, it seems, is to continue on separately, even if it means some might never return...
Wednesday, November 16th The groups proceed down their paths, having a grand ol' time.
Thursday, November 17th The groups proceed down their paths, having an even grander ol' time. Meanwhile, back at the castle, a flare is seen in the sky, but there's no way of telling where, exactly, it came from. It's a signal, but who is it for?
Friday, November 18th The residents regroup and regather. Everyone's more than ready to go home and rest and reflect and do other things that start with 'R', but is Paradisa really where they want to go?
Saturday, November 19th Hours before the residents reach the border, chaos erupts back at the castle.
